Output 17b6027e5eff134834e4197e5fc54470821ca5423ab45955e522603078912ef1:21

value
156989
script pubkey
OP_0 OP_PUSHBYTES_32 c053cae0c8e25321b093884655bbe2e7ccf754a071ef67337df5029c9edad9bd
address
bc1qcpfu4cxguffjrvyn3pr9twlzulx0w49qw8hkwvma75pfe8k6mx7s0f63s8
transaction
17b6027e5eff134834e4197e5fc54470821ca5423ab45955e522603078912ef1